What is the need to use stealth technology?

Stealth technology is used to make an aircraft or seacraft undetectable or hard to detect by radar technology. It is employed on the Boeing B2 Spirit bomber so that a potential target would not be able to detect the aircraft until its too late. Stealth technology can be used to penetrate automated defense systems and strike a target, or pave the way for non-stealth aircraft. -K


What makes a stealth plane unable to be seen on radar?

Stealth aircraft are extremely hard to detect on radar because they use a variety of advanced technologies that reduce reflection/emission of radar, infrared, visible light, radio-frequency spectrum, and audio. Early stealth aircraft were aerodynamically unstable.


What is the difference between stealth aircraft and commercial aircraft?

Stealth aircraft are made so they don't show up on radar very well, or at all. This is important if you're going out to blow something up and don't want to be seen. Commercial aircraft could not be stealth aircraft because you really need to be able to see one on radar. Air Traffic Control uses radar to detect aircraft in its area, other planes use radar to detect you in the sky...having a commercial plane that couldn't be seen on radar would be very bad. - - - - - the difference is like police and thief.
